When is the best time of year to stay in a hostel in Pecatu?
Good weather’s definitely a plus when you’re discovering new places, so here’s a little information about the seasons: The hottest months are usually March and April, with an average temperature of 27°C, while the coldest months are August and September, with an average of 26°C. The rainiest months in Pecatu are December, January, November and February, with each month seeing an average of 264 mm of rainfall.
What is there to see and do in Pecatu?
Generally, Pecatu is known for its surfing, temples and beaches. Major attractions include Uluwatu Temple, Nusa Dua Beach and Kuta Beach. Get out into nature with places such as Padang Padang Beach, Bingin Beach and Thomas Beach. Cultural attractions include Bali Nusa Dua Theater, TAKSU Bali Gallery and Bali Museum.
What's the best way to get to and around Pecatu while staying at a hostel?
Keep this information about transit options in and around Pecatu on hand to make the most of your stay: You can fly into the nearest airport, which is Denpasar (DPS-Ngurah Rai Intl.), 6.6 mi (10.6 km) from the city centre.
